What is Brick Tinting?
Put in a nutshell, brick tinting is considered to be the single most efficient and cost-effective method of making permanent changes to the colour of mortar, bricks and other masonry substrates. A successful technique used for 40 years or so, the process involves application of a potassium-silicate medium containing oxide-based colour-fast pigments to the surface of bricks and other masonry surfaces.
How it Works
The tint used is not a type of surface coating or paint, but a combination of a liquid chemical binder (the potassium-silicate) to which iron oxide pigments have been added. On application, this mixture penetrates into the brick/masonry substrate, where it forms a permanent bond. In essence, the process enables lightening, darkening or a complete change of brick/substrate colours in order to achieve an exact match to specific requirements.
